Abstract

The invention discloses a component type high-pressure common rail device. A common rail pipe is provided with a pressure sensor and a pressure limiter. The common rail pipe comprises an inner pipe and an outer pipe; a circumferential limit device is arranged between the inner pipe and the outer pipe; the two ends of the outer pipe are fixedly sleeved with a seal cover and the seal covers are used for sealing the two ends of the outer pipe; the circumferential surface of the common rail pipe is provided with an oil inlet and multiple oil outlets; and on the inner circumferential surface of the inner pipe, an annular inward-convex table stretching along the circumferential direction of the inner pipe is respectively arranged between the oil inlet and an oil outlet adjacent to the oil inlet and between two adjacent oil outlets. The component type high-pressure common rail device disclosed by the invention can improve the pressure stability in the common rail pipe, reduce the fluctuation of pressure, and guarantee stability of fuel injection of the high-pressure common rail system.

Description

technical field [0001] The invention relates to a component-type high-pressure common rail device, in particular to a component-type high-pressure common-rail device for a diesel engine high-pressure common-rail fuel injection system. Background technique [0002] In recent years, the country has increasingly strict requirements on diesel engines in terms of energy saving and environmental protection. In order to save energy and reduce emissions, the high-pressure common rail electronically controlled fuel injection technology, which is known for its flexible control, has become an important direction for the development of diesel engine technology.
